
Argentina MPs approve bill allowing mining in glaciers | Environment News
Argentina’s Chamber of Deputies approved an amendment to the Glacier Law, allowing mining in ecologically sensitive areas of glaciers and permafrost. The move was met with widespread protests from environmentalists who argue it threatens water resources. Javier Milei, president of Argentina, championed the bill, claiming it is necessary to attract large-scale mining projects. Environmental activist Flavia Broffoni refuted this claim, stating that there is no possibility of creating a sustainable mine in such an environment. The amendment now heads to the Senate for further consideration.
